About Mount Johns

Mount Johns is an outer suburb of Alice Springs in the Northern Territory, located south of the town centre within the Town of Alice Springs local government area. The suburb sits within the arid landscape of Central Australia, characterised by red desert soil and sparse vegetation typical of the region. Mount Johns is bounded by the suburbs of Hale to the south-west, Ross to the south-east and The Gap to the north, and forms part of the broader Alice Springs urban area in the Red Centre.
